Pender Island Ultra-Low Energy Home

My first house built with the Passive House method!  This is a very difficult lot for a Passive House, so the goal was not Passive House certification, but to achieve the best practical and cost effective level of performance. The house faces west/north west with a wall of trees to the south so the energy balance is tricky. When planning windows in a Passive House, we balance the solar gains to utilize the free energy from the sun while minimizing the risk of overheating and balance those gains against heat losses.

Occupants of a Passive House enjoy optimum comfort, excellent indoor air quality and also use up to 90% less energy for space heating. One of the most important aspects of a Passive House is that it does not require the occupants to change the way they live.
